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Traefik
- No transparent pricing displayed for Traefik Hub API Gateway or API Management products
- No subscription period specified for paid tiers
- Traefik Hub products require contacting sales for pricing
VerneMQ
- The official binaries and Docker images are not Apache 2.0 but sit under a EULA requiring a yearly commercial subscription, a distinction easy to miss and awkward to discover during a licence audit.
- Octavo Labs is a very small company, so support depth, response times and the bus factor on the codebase are materially thinner than at HiveMQ or EMQ.
- There is no data integration or rule engine layer, so routing messages into a database means writing and operating your own consumer service.
- Operating an Erlang cluster requires runtime knowledge that most teams do not have and will use for nothing else in their stack.
- There is no vendor-managed cloud offering, so every deployment is self-operated with the infrastructure and on-call cost that implies.

Answered from the vendors’ own pages
Traefik: Is Traefik Proxy free to use?
Yes, Traefik Proxy is completely free and open source. You can download and use it at no cost.
SourceVerneMQ: Is VerneMQ free?
The source is Apache 2.0 and free. The official binary packages and Docker images are covered by a separate EULA that expects a yearly fee for commercial use.
Traefik: What pricing model does Traefik use for its paid products?
Traefik Hub products (API Gateway and API Management) use quote-based pricing. Specific rates are not published on the pricing page; you must contact sales to request pricing.
SourceVerneMQ: Is the project still maintained?
Yes. Octavo Labs AG in Zurich continues to publish 2.x releases, most recently in 2026.
VerneMQ: Does it have a managed cloud?
No. Every deployment is self-hosted, with commercial support available from Octavo Labs.
VerneMQ: How does it compare to EMQX?
Narrower in features and without a rule engine, but with a simpler licence story for source builds after EMQX moved to BSL.
